CES Highlights Korea's Tech Growth Challenges
5.8

At CES 2026 in Las Vegas, the tech fair raised alarm bells for Korea’s tech firms, signaling that long-term growth cannot rely merely on existing strategies as the industry shifts toward 'physical AI'.
